What Are the Symptoms of Brake Drum Failure in My Chevy Sprint?

Brake drum failure in your Chevy Sprint can manifest through several noticeable symptoms. Common signs include a grinding or scraping noise when braking, a pulsating brake pedal, reduced braking efficiency, and the vehicle pulling to one side during stops. If you notice any of these issues, it's crucial to inspect the brake drums for wear or damage. Addressing these symptoms early can prevent more extensive repairs and ensure your Chevy Sprint's braking system remains reliable.

How Much Do Rear Brake Drum Replacements Cost for My Chevy Suburban R10?

The cost of replacing rear brake drums on a Chevy Suburban R10 can vary depending on whether you choose aftermarket or OEM parts. On average, the price for parts alone ranges from $50 to $150 per drum. If you opt for professional installation, labor costs can add an additional $100 to $200, bringing the total cost to approximately $200 to $400 per axle. Using genuine OEM brake drums is recommended for longevity and performance, as they are designed to fit your vehicle’s specifications precisely.

Can I Replace My Old Chevy Silverado Brake Drums Myself, or Should I See Professional Replacement?

Replacing brake drums on your Chevy Silverado 1500 can be a DIY project if you have the right tools and mechanical experience. The process involves lifting the vehicle, removing the wheels, and detaching the old brake drums before installing new ones. However, it's essential to check for other components like brake shoes and springs that may also need replacement. If you're unfamiliar with brake systems or lack the necessary tools, it may be safer to seek professional help. Incorrect installation can lead to braking issues, compromising your vehicle's safety.
